Medina county dems to hold mock presidential caucus
Dems sponsor mock caucus

Who will Medina County choose as the Democratic Presidential nominee?

Learn about the caucus process at Medina County's Mock Democratic Caucus from 8:30 to 11 a.m. Aug. 25 at the Grace Drake Center, 222 S. Broadway St., Medina.

"Eight Democratic presidential campaign representatives will talk up their candidates before caucus-goers split up into precincts and vote," said Julie Batey, president of Medina County Democratic Women.

4. Edwards wins mock caucus
"Round 2 voting determined that John Edwards was Medina County's choice with Dennis Kucinch coming in second, Bill Richardson in third and Hillary Clinton in last place."
